FutureRange acquires Echo IT in second Irish digital transformation deal of 2026

Author: Archie Villaflores

Irish IT managed service provider FutureRange has completed its second acquisition of 2026 with the purchase of Nenagh-based Echo IT, strengthening its Munster presence as part of an all-island growth strategy. The deal broadens FutureRange's regional delivery across cyber security, cloud and managed IT services.

Ubotica partners with NOVI Space to deliver real-time AI intelligence from orbit

Author: Archie Villaflores

Irish space-based AI company Ubotica Technologies has partnered with Canadian orbit edge computing firm NOVI Space to enable real-time AI inference directly onboard satellites. The collaboration integrates Ubotica's SPACE:AI platform with NOVI's GENIE smart-satellite constellation.

Orchard wins Precision Group mandate to drive digital transformation across retail and commercial property portfolio

Author: Archie Villaflores

Australian connected experience agency Orchard has been appointed by private investment company Precision Group to lead the digital transformation of its retail and commercial property portfolio. Six new websites are set to launch in July 2026 as the first phase of a broader programme.
